BMW Motorrad Exeter Technician Named Divisional Colleague Of The Year

Damian Smith has been named as Motorcycle Division Colleague of the Year at the annual Vertu Masters Awards.

The Masters Awards are held annually and recognise the best non-management colleagues from across the Group working in a variety of roles.

Damian, a Master Technician at BMW Motorrad Exeter, was named as winner of the Motorcycle Division Colleague of the Year against competition from Vertu’s network of seven motorcycle dealerships spread across the country.

Those seven sites run from the BMW Motorrad dealership in Exeter as far north as Sunderland, and includes dealerships representing both Honda and Ducati.

Having only joined Vertu in early 2025, Damian was praised for the immediate impact he has made at the dealership on Matford Park Road, with particular emphasis on his dedication, teamwork and leadership.

Damian was also praised the fact he consistently goes above and beyond in his role, with his positive attitude helping to boost team morale across the Exeter dealership.

Damian Smith said: “I’m hugely proud to even be nominated for this award, so to be named the winner is fantastic.

“It’s nice to be recognised for the work that I do, but this award is also a reflection of the wider team at the dealership as it wouldn’t have been possible without them.”

Robert Forrester, Vertu Chief Executive, said: “Damian’s nomination was a clear indication of the impact he has had on the BMW Motorrad Exeter dealership, and he richly deserves this accolade.

“The way in which he supports those around him, and his desire to always provide customers with the best possible experience, is exactly what we want from our colleagues and he should be rightly proud at being named as our Motorcycle Division Colleague of the Year.”

Alongside picking up his Masters Award trophy, Damian will also be invited to attend a special Long Service Event later in the year alongside fellow Masters Award winners.
